package Stem::Cell ;
use strict ;
sub cell_cloneable {
my( $self ) = @_ ;
my $cell_info = $self->_get_cell_info() ;
return $cell_info->{'cloneable'} ;
}
#####################
#####################
# add check of max clone count
#####################
#####################
my @clone_fields = qw(
no_io
data_addr
errors_to_output
pipe_addr
pipe_args
codec
work_ready_addr
trigger_method
sequence_done_method
send_data_on_close
stderr_log
) ;
sub _clone {
my( $cell_info ) = @_ ;
my $owner_obj = $cell_info->{'owner_obj'} ;
return $owner_obj unless $cell_info->{'cloneable'} ;
# copy the object
my $clone = bless { %{$owner_obj} }, ref $owner_obj ;
# get a new target id and the cell name
my $target = $cell_info->{'id_obj'}->next() ;
my $cell_name = $cell_info->{'cell_name'} ;
# keep track of the clone in the parent and register it
$cell_info->{'clones'}{$target} = $clone ;
my $err = register_cell( $clone, $cell_name, $target ) ;
die $err if $err ;
# the parent loses its args to the clone. parent cells never do real work
##################
## add parent private INFO/ARGS for use by status command
##################
my $args = delete $cell_info->{'args'} ;
# create the clone info and save it in the cloned object
my $cell_info_attr = $cell_info->{'cell_info_attr'} ;
my $from_addr = Stem::Msg::make_address_string(
$Stem::Vars::Hub_name,
$cell_name,
$target
) ;
#print "FROM ADDR $cell_info->{'from_addr'}\n" ;
my $clone_info = bless {
'owner_obj' => $clone,
'parent_obj' => $owner_obj,
'cell_name' => $cell_name,
'target' => $target,
'from_addr' => $from_addr,
'args' => $args,
'cell_info_attr' => $cell_info_attr,
map { $_ => $cell_info->{$_} } @clone_fields,
} ;
# save the new clone info into the clone itself ;
$clone->{$cell_info_attr} = $clone_info ;
return $clone ;
}
sub _clone_delete {
my ( $self ) = @_ ;
my $parent_obj = $self->{'parent_obj'} ;
return unless $parent_obj ;
my $owner_obj = $self->{'owner_obj'} ;
my $cell_info_attr = $self->{'cell_info_attr'} ;
#print $self->cell_status_cmd() ;
# break all circular links
# delete the refs to the parent and parent objects in the cell info
# and the owner object ref to this cell info
delete @{$self}{ qw( owner_obj parent_obj ) } ;
delete $owner_obj->{$cell_info_attr} ;
delete $self->{'args'} ;
# clean up the parent clones hash and the registry
my $parent_info = $parent_obj->{$cell_info_attr} ;
my $target = $self->{'target'} ;
delete $parent_info->{'clones'}{$target} ;
$parent_info->{'id_obj'}->delete( $target ) ;
my $err = unregister_cell( $owner_obj ) ;
}
1 ;
